Hugging Face for Startups refers collectively to the in-kind support channels operated by Hugging Face, the New York City-based open-source AI platform company founded in 2016 with a mission to democratize machine learning. The primary first-party program is the Community GPU Grants track, which allocates in-kind GPU compute — defaulting to ZeroGPU (Nvidia RTX Pro 6000 Blackwell, up to 96 GB GPU memory) or A10G in some cases — to qualifying public Spaces projects on the Hugging Face Hub. Applications are submitted directly through a Space's hardware settings. A secondary channel routes Pro-account credits (six months of Hugging Face Pro free) through partner accelerators and startup-perks marketplaces such as FounderPass and XRaise; these are not a structured first-party grant program with a public application page.

For the Community GPU Grants track, awards are in-kind compute with an implied monthly retail equivalent of roughly $720–$1,800 for ZeroGPU or A10G usage at continuous utilization. No cash is disbursed. Grants are temporary and may be removed if usage is low; duration is case-by-case with no fixed term. Eligibility favors academic research projects, open-source community demos, and projects with demonstrated traction (visits, GitHub stars, published papers). There are no geographic restrictions and no funding-stage requirements, making the track accessible to individuals, academic teams, and indie developers alongside startups. Structured fields indicate the award range at $500 to $100,000, reflecting the wide variance across different support tiers.

Teams seeking meaningful GPU allocation for applied AI or ML research should apply via the Space hardware settings on huggingface.co and demonstrate a working, publicly accessible project with clear community value. Startups seeking Pro credits via accelerator partnerships should look for Hugging Face listed in their accelerator's perks marketplace rather than applying directly through a Hugging Face grant portal.
